Overview of DMP45H4D9HK3-13 by Diodes Incorporated

The DMP45H4D9HK3-13 is a P-Channel MOSFET characterized by a drain-source breakdown voltage of 450 V, a maximum drain current of 3 A, and a drain-source on-resistance of 4.9 Ω. Packaged in a TO-252 (DPAK-3/2), this component features a single element configuration, made with silicon and utilizing metal-oxide semiconductor technology. As part of the Power Field-Effect Transistors subcategory, it is designed for high efficiency and power handling in a compact form factor.

Manufactured by Diodes Incorporated, the DMP45H4D9HK3-13 was introduced on June 5, 2017, and is currently active in the market. It boasts compliance with RoHS and a JEDEC-95 designation of TO-252 for its package. The component features a high avalanche energy rating of 187 mJ and is designed for operation in enhancement mode. Its package is constructed from plastic/epoxy, ensuring durability and resilience in a variety of conditions. It is notable for its surface-mount capability, moisture sensitivity level of 1, and a maximum pulsed drain current (IDM) of 4.5 A.

Industry Applications for DMP45H4D9HK3-13

The DMP45H4D9HK3-13 is versatile in its potential applications across several industries. It’s important to emphasize that the suitability of this part for specific applications needs careful consideration and verification against industry standards and application-specific requirements. Here are some key industries and potential use cases:

  • Consumer Electronics: In consumer electronics, the DMP45H4D9HK3-13 might find applications in power supply circuits for devices such as laptops, smartphones, and tablets. Its high breakdown voltage and compact size make it suitable for managing power in devices with stringent space and power efficiency requirements.
  • Audio and Video Systems: This transistor could potentially be used in the power management systems of audio amplifiers, AV receivers, and high-definition television sets. Its efficiency in switching and power handling capabilities could improve the overall power efficiency of these systems.
  • Entertainment and Gaming: The gaming industry, particularly in the design of gaming consoles and VR/AR systems, might utilize the DMP45H4D9HK3-13 for power regulation and management. Its fast switching speeds and low on-resistance are beneficial for devices requiring rapid, efficient power distribution to deliver immersive gaming experiences.
  • Industrial Power Supplies: Industrial applications, such as automation and control systems, could benefit from the efficiency and reliability of the DMP45H4D9HK3-13 in managing high-voltage power supplies and conversions. This ensures stable operation in environments that demand high performance and durability.
